Costco

Costco is renowned for its wide selection of quality fitness equipment. Its treadmills are no exception. These treadmills are available in a variety of sizes, speeds, and features to meet the needs of all types of users. These machines are manufactured by reputable manufacturers like NordicTrack or ProForm and feature Johnson Drive System Motors for smooth operation and long-lasting. Treadmills can help you remain active and improve your health. They can help you shed weight, build muscle, and burn calories. They can also be used to train for a race or marathon. It is important to choose the correct treadmill before you make the purchase.

Costco provides a range of treadmills from various brands, including high-end commercial-grade, smart, and self-propelled models. These treadmills can be incorporated in your home gym to meet your needs for exercise. They offer an area of running that is up to 55 inches and inclines up to 15 percent, and speeds of up to 12 miles per hour. They can accommodate a maximum trainee weight of 300 pounds.

The current Costco treadmill selection includes models from the Echelon brand as well as other well-known brands, like NordicTrack and ProForm. These models feature a variety of features, ranging from high-end touchscreen interfaces to built-in entertainment systems. They also come with iFIT, which gives you access to thousands of fitness-related interactive videos on the go. It is important to know that the models at Costco might not be the most current models on the market. Many of these models are discontinued by their manufacturers and may not come with a warranty.

Costco treadmills are typically less expensive than those purchased directly from the manufacturers. The retailer sells treadmills in huge quantities for a price that is lower, resulting in lower prices. This can make a treadmill less expensive for those on budgets that are tight. Additionally, those who have an Executive level membership can earn cash back of 2% on purchases, including treadmills.

Treadmill workouts can get monotonous, so it's important to mix up your routine. Some methods to do this are adding intervals and increasing the slope. You'll be less likely to give up when you alter your routine. It can make your workouts more exciting and challenging. Other methods to boost your motivation include watching your favorite TV show or streaming a virtual run on beautiful scenery.

Apart from being a great means to stay fit it can also be used to prepare for marathons and other long distance races. It lets you exercise in a safe and secure environment without having to worry about weather, traffic, or street harassment. You can train with a partner or a friend which can add a social element. Using a treadmill can also be a great cardio workout for people with physical limitations, such as osteoarthritis or chronic back pain.

Running on treadmills with an incline is an excellent way to test yourself without increasing your risk of injury. Running uphill helps strengthen the muscles that support hips, ankles, and knees. It also reduces the impact on your neck, back and joints as compared to flat-running. Additionally, incline training can help you reach your goals quicker.

To keep track of your progress it's recommended to keep track of your heart rate when you exercise on a treadmill. This can be done in several ways, including by wearing a fitness tracker equipped with a heart rate sensor or using a mobile app that calculates your pulse rate. You can also use the rate of perceived exertion scale (RPE) to gauge your intensity. A score between 5 and 7 is considered moderate intensity, which means that you are working hard enough to feel the heartbeat pounding, but not too difficult to be unable keep a conversation going.

Walmart

Walmart has a large range of low-cost treadmills. They have a variety of features and models from basic to advanced. A lot of them have book racks and accessory holders for reading material, remote treadmills small control, or other items. They also come with the ability to measure hand-grip pulse which allows you to remain in your training zone. If you're restricted in space, you should consider a treadmill that folds down to conserve space. These kinds of treadmills can be placed under a desk or into the closet.

Before purchasing a treadmill, consider your goals for fitness and your lifestyle. If you're an occasional runner, you might not need a treadmill with a maximum speed of 12 mph. If you're interested in running uphill, look for a machine with an adjustable incline. You can increase the resistance of your exercise by adjusting the incline setting.

Another important factor is the size of the treadmill's deck. A narrow or short deck can restrict your natural stride, making it difficult to find a suitable rhythm. For those who are tall, look at a deck that has a wider surface. If you want to use your treadmill for running or walking, you should be aware of the number of pre-programmed exercises it has. This will allow you to stick with your workout routine and reach your fitness goals faster.

Other considerations to be aware of when shopping for a treadmill include assembly, weight and price. Some treadmills are fully assembled, while others require complicated assembly, which can be difficult for even DIYers. Ask the seller these questions before you make the purchase. Make sure to check the warranty to be sure that it covers the motor and frame. Ideally, the treadmill should come with a warranty of at least two years. If it doesn't, look for a new model.
